Transaction f678bafcec5f4e2add6b76a36642d1614521d8f0c3374f1d2bddcb720f153b17

4 Input
2 Outputs
  • f678bafcec5f4e2add6b76a36642d1614521d8f0c3374f1d2bddcb720f153b17:0
  • value  916376
    address  3EjdVHTKnXG5LmyxtHYPdcDwvvgcmCGZaV
  • f678bafcec5f4e2add6b76a36642d1614521d8f0c3374f1d2bddcb720f153b17:1
  • value  134192100
    address  17JFsbbZAckaqueyvsniw1nrMSTsQt1tZF